一、 Openfiler简介

  Openfiler 能把标准x86/64架构的系统变成一个强大的NAS、SAN存储和IP存储网关,为管理员提供一个强大的管理平台,并能能应付未来的存储需求。依赖如VMware,Virtual Iron和Xen服务器虚拟化技术,Openfiler也可部署为一个虚拟机实例。Openfiler这种灵活高效的部署方式,确保存储管理员能够在一个或多个网络存储环境下使系统的性能和存储资源得到最佳的利用和分配。

Openfiler的主要功能

  Openfiler 开源存储管理平台,控制您的存储设备:

  集成SAN和NAS等多种功能

  高可用性故障切换功能

  块级别的远程复制和灾难恢复

  功能强大的网页管理界面

  本地化语种使设置更方便

  NFS网络优化:NFS客户端访问调优,优化了多用户写入、同步、端口等

  增强的CIFS选项:高级CIFS共享配置,对应用程序的兼容性更强

  多网卡绑定:可创建多网卡的绑定配置,以提高数据的传输性能

  高级ISCSI设置:可创建多个iSCSI目标和LUN,并且可以建立数据快照

  统一存储 NAS / SAN

  iSCSI target功能

  支持CIFS和NFS的HTTP,FTP协议

  支持的RAID 0,1,5,6,10

  裸机或虚拟化安装部署

  支持8TB以上的日志文件系统

  文件系统的访问控制列表

  时间点副本(快照)的支持

  动态卷管理器

  强大的基于Web的管理

  块级别的远程复制

  高可用性集群

  本地化语种使设置更方便

Openfiler的主要性能和优点

  可靠性:Openfiler可以支持软件和硬件的RAID,能监测和预警,并且可以做卷的快照和快速恢复。

  高可用性:Openfiler支持主动或被动的高可用性集群、多路径存储(MPIO)、块级别的复制。

  性能:及时更新的Linux内核支持最新的CPU、网络和存储硬件。

  可伸缩性:文件系统可扩展性最高可超出60TB,并能使文件系统大小可以在线的增长。

Openfiler部署方案

  Openfiler提供了一系列的存储网络协议,使之成为多种部署方案的最佳选择:

  A、存储区域网络

  IP存储网关

  磁盘到磁盘备份

  视频监控

  Oracle 10g的原始卷

  虚拟机迁移

  持续数据保护

  B、网络附加存储

  异构的文件共享

  Exchange后端服务器

  虚拟机的存储后端

  网络用户的主目录

  媒体归档

Openfiler经济高效的存储

  Openfiler是一个商业上可行的开源NAS / SAN解决方案,并能应付复杂的存储管理需求。

  首先,它可以安装在x86/64架构的工业标准服务器上,否定了昂贵的专有存储系统的需求。只需要10分钟即可把系统部署到戴尔、惠普、IBM等标准配置服务器上,服务器即变成一个功能强大的网络存储设备了。

  此外,与其它存储解决方案不同的是,Openfiler的管理是通过一个强大的、直观的基于Web的图形用户界面。 通过这个界面,管理员可以执行诸如创建卷、网络共享磁盘分配用户和组的配额和管理RAID阵列等各项工作。

  作为一个纯软件的解决方案,Openfiler可以在几分钟内下载并安装在任何工业标准的硬件上。这是全新部署或重新启用老的硬件资源的完美解决方案。它可以用来建立已有部署SAN或DAS存储系统的存储网关。 在这种情况下,Openfiler是创建共享现有存储容量的新途径。

Openfiler广泛的硬件兼容性

  Openfiler支持大量的SCSI硬件RAID、SATA、SAS、光纤通道控制器的磁盘技术。还可以将Broadcom、英特尔的千兆和万兆以太网控制器绑定,使其接入TCP/IP协议网络数据的速度成倍提高。当然,无论是英特尔至强?和AMD Opteron? 系列的x86/64处理器,还有IBM、英特尔、HP、LSI Logic等厂家的RAID控制器,用于光纤通道的PCI-E和PCI-X接口的QLogic和Emulex的总线适配器。Openfiler与各种网络接口控制器,包括英特尔、Broadcom等,甚至是对高端的Infiniband设备的兼容性都非常的优秀。Openfiler将继续支持更多新硬件、新技术和解决方案,努力成为网络存储领域的中坚力量。

Openfiler丰富的协议

  支持多种文件级别和块级别的数据存储输出协议,几乎涵盖现有全部的网络存储服务。

  块级别协议: iSCSI、光纤通道

  文件级别协议:NFS、CIFS、HTTP/DAV、FTP、rsync

Openfiler强大的管理功能

  现有的存储解决方案中基本都存在管理能力不足的缺点。Openfiler面对这一挑战,相对同类解决方案强化了其直观且易于操作的基于Web的图形用户界面(GUI)。 Openfiler中所有网络功能和存储方面的设置均通过这个管理界面来完成。 管理界面分为网络、物理卷、用户和组的认证/授权、系统配置和状态信息等。

  在基础层面,磁盘或其他块级别的资源分配,如硬件的RAID卷等可以在物理卷的管理功能里实现。 物理卷管理又由几个子功能组成,其中包括逻辑卷分配和副本(快照)管理等。

  管理员也许会更欣赏用户和组的认证/授权功能,可以进行资源限制与配额管理。 Openfiler支持为用户和组的配额管理,存储资源的分配规则允许管理员控制用户使用磁盘的容量等,还能限制一个用户所能使用的文件和目录的数目。 如果一个组被分配一定的资源,管理员可以进一步限制在该组中特定用户的资源。 这种理粒度级别的资源管理是OpenfilerS值得强调的。

  Openfiler还可以让系统管理员实时的查看到系统的详细状态,如内存,处理器和存储容量的资源使用。 这可以让管理员更好地计划未来的资源分配需求。

openfiler的介绍与使用的更多相关文章

  1. 存储管理(一):openfiler介绍及存储理解

    openfiler是一个免费的.开源的基于浏览器的网络存储产品,支持基于文件的的网络连接存储(NAS)和基于块的存储区域网(SAN).支持的协议有smb,cifs,nfs,http/dev和ftp. ...

  2. 使用OpenFiler来模拟存储配置RAC中ASM共享盘及多路径(multipath)的测试

    第一章 本篇总览 之前发布了一篇<Oracle_lhr_RAC 12cR1安装>,但是其中的存储并没有使用多路径,而是使用了VMware自身提供的存储.所以,年前最后一件事就是把多路径学习 ...

  3. oracle 11g r2 rac +openfiler 2.99 +centos 6.5+vbox

    继上篇openfiler 2.99安装之后,这一篇讲介绍openfiler的存储配置和oracle 端的服务配置 参考文档:https://www.oracle.com/technetwork/cn/ ...

  4. 虚拟化笔记04.OpenFiler.install

    4.OpenFiler install OPENFILER 介绍 1.OpenFiler 作用 OpenFiler 基于Linux 内核,主要作用是实现IP-SAN. 在VSPHERE中我们可以将VM ...

  5. (转)利用openfiler实现iSCSI

    转自:http://czmmiao.iteye.com/blog/1735417 openfiler openfiler是一个基于浏览器的网络存储管理工具.来自于Linux系统.openfiler在一 ...

  6. CSS3 background-image背景图片相关介绍

    这里将会介绍如何通过background-image设置背景图片,以及背景图片的平铺.拉伸.偏移.设置大小等操作. 1. 背景图片样式分类 CSS中设置元素背景图片及其背景图片样式的属性主要以下几个: ...

  7. MySQL高级知识- MySQL的架构介绍

    [TOC] 1.MySQL 简介 概述 MySQL是一个关系型数据库管理系统,由瑞典MySQL AB公司开发,目前属于Oracle公司. MySQL是一种关联数据库管理系统,将数据保存在不同的表中,而 ...

  8. Windows Server 2012 NIC Teaming介绍及注意事项

    Windows Server 2012 NIC Teaming介绍及注意事项 转载自:http://www.it165.net/os/html/201303/4799.html Windows Ser ...

  9. Linux下服务器端开发流程及相关工具介绍(C++)

    去年刚毕业来公司后,做为新人,发现很多东西都没有文档,各种工具和地址都是口口相传的,而且很多时候都是不知道有哪些工具可以使用,所以当时就想把自己接触到的这些东西记录下来,为后来者提供参考,相当于一个路 ...

随机推荐

  1. transfrom-runtime文档

    transfrom-runtime文档 babel只会默认对句法进行转换,而那些方法,api不会转换,要转就要使用polyfill和transform,这里介绍transform,关于polyfill ...

  2. Django界面不能添加中文解决办法

    Django项目部署好后,界面添加中文会报错,解决办法: 创建数据库时要指定编码格式: CREATE DATABASE blog CHARACTER SET utf8; 如果已经创建完毕则修改: al ...

  3. delphi IOS发布添加其他资源文件

    添加自己的文件. Project>Deployment>Add File Remote Path android and IOS: assets\internal\ TPath.GetDo ...

  4. Wcf调用方式

    C#动态调用WCF接口,两种方式任你选.   写在前面 接触WCF还是它在最初诞生之处,一个分布式应用的巨作. 从开始接触到现在断断续续,真正使用的项目少之又少,更谈不上深入WCF内部实现机制和原理去 ...

  5. logback-spring.xml的schema

    <?xml version="1.0" encoding="utf-8" ?> <configuration xmlns:xsi=" ...

  6. Using Browser Link in Visual Studio 2013

    题记:Browser Link是VS 2013开始引入的一个强大功能,让前端代码(比如AngularJS的代码)在VS中的修改更加轻而易举. 前 端代码是运行在浏览器中,而Visual Studio通 ...

  7. 【HDU6026】Deleting Edges

    题意 有一个n个节点的无向图,结点编号从0-n-1,每条边的长度时1to9的一个正整数.现在要删除一些边(或者不删),使得到的新图满足下面两个要求. 1.新图是一颗树有n-1条边2.对于每个结点v(0 ...

  8. uva1619

    分析:这个题的关键是要找到,当某个值是最小值时它最大的影响区间时什么.可以通过单调队列(单调栈)在nlogn的时间内实现 #include <cstdio> #include <cs ...

  9. libevent源码深度剖析四

    libevent源码深度剖析四 ——libevent源代码文件组织 1 前言 详细分析源代码之前,如果能对其代码文件的基本结构有个大概的认识和分类,对于代码的分析将是大有裨益的.本节内容不多,我想并不 ...

  10. Python中sort与sorted函数

    python中列表的内置函数sort()可以对列表中的元素进行排序,而全局性的sorted()函数则对所有可迭代的序列都是适用的: 并且sort()函数是内置函数,会改变当前对象,而sorted()函 ...